### PHASE 2: GAP TYPOLOGY

**Objective:** Classify identified gaps using the seven-type taxonomy to ensure comprehensive coverage and avoid over-concentration on a single gap type.

#### Gap Types

| # | Gap Type | Definition | Diagnostic Question |
|---|----------|-----------|-------------------|
| 1 | **Knowledge Gap** | What is not yet known about a phenomenon | "What do we still not understand about X?" |
| 2 | **Method Gap** | Existing methods are inadequate or absent | "How could we study X more rigorously?" |
| 3 | **Theory Gap** | No adequate theoretical explanation exists | "Why does X occur — and can we explain it?" |
| 4 | **Application Gap** | Knowledge exists but is not applied | "How can we use what we know about X to solve Y?" |
| 5 | **Replication Gap** | Findings lack independent replication | "Has X been replicated in different contexts?" |
| 6 | **Population Gap** | Findings limited to specific populations | "Does X hold for underrepresented group Z?" |
| 7 | **Mechanistic Gap** | Correlation known but mechanism unknown | "Through what process does X lead to Y?" |

#### Gap Assessment Matrix
For each identified gap, score on:

- **Severity** (1-5): How significant is the gap's absence for the field?
- **Feasibility** (1-5): How tractable is addressing this gap with available resources?
- **Impact** (1-5): How much would closing this gap advance knowledge?
- **Novelty** (1-5): How many existing studies already target this gap?

Compute the **Gap Priority Index (GPI)** = (Severity × 0.3) + (Feasibility × 0.2) + (Impact × 0.3) + (Novelty × 0.2)

Rank gaps by GPI descending. Only gaps scoring ≥ 3.0 should advance to Phase 3.

**Quality Gate:** Must produce at least 3 gaps spanning at least 2 different gap types. No more than 40% of gaps should be of a single type.

### PHASE 3: QUESTION FORGE

**Objective:** Transform validated gaps into precise, answerable, and novel research questions.

#### Research Question Template
```
[UNDER WHAT CONDITIONS / HOW / WHY / TO WHAT EXTENT]
does [INDEPENDENT VARIABLE / INTERVENTION / EXPOSURE]
[affect / influence / moderate / mediate / predict]
[DEPENDENT VARIABLE / OUTCOME]
in [POPULATION / CONTEXT]
given [THEORETICAL LENS / MECHANISM]?
```

#### Five-Dimensional Scoring

| Dimension | Weight | Scoring Criteria |
|-----------|--------|-----------------|
| **Specificity** | 0.20 | 1=Vague topic area → 5=Precise variables, direction, and population specified |
| **Answerability** | 0.20 | 1=Unanswerable with any method → 5=Clearly answerable with standard methods |
| **Novelty** | 0.25 | 1=Already answered in literature → 5=No prior work addresses this |
| **Impact** | 0.20 | 1=Niche interest only → 5=Field-altering implications |
| **Groundedness** | 0.15 | 1=No theoretical basis → 5=Directly derived from established theory |

**Research Question Quality Index (RQI)** = Σ(Dimension Score × Weight)

**RQI Interpretation:**
- 4.0–5.0: Excellent — proceed directly to Phase 4
- 3.0–3.9: Good — refine wording and re-score
- 2.0–2.9: Marginal — return to Phase 2 and identify alternative gap
- Below 2.0: Unviable — discard and restart

#### Question Refinement Checklist
- [ ] Variables are operationally definable
- [ ] The question implies a falsifiable hypothesis
- [ ] The population is specified and accessible
- [ ] The scope is neither too broad nor too narrow
- [ ] The question is not a disguised "does X exist?" (trivial)
- [ ] The question does not presuppose its answer
- [ ] Alternative explanations are acknowledged

**Quality Gate:** Must produce at least 2 research questions per gap, select the highest RQI question, and verify it scores ≥ 3.5.

### PHASE 4: CONTRIBUTION MAPPING

**Objective:** Forecast and articulate the specific contributions the proposed research will make across four domains.

#### Contribution Domains

**4.1 Theoretical Contribution**
- New theory construction: Does this create a new theoretical framework?
- Theory extension: Does this extend an existing theory to a new domain?
- Theory refinement: Does this refine or qualify an existing theory?
- Theory integration: Does this bridge two or more theoretical traditions?
- Theory falsification: Does this test a theory's predictions under new conditions?

**4.2 Methodological Contribution**
- New measure/instrument development
- Novel analytical approach or statistical technique
- Improved research design for existing questions
- New data collection methodology
- Validation of existing methods in new contexts

**4.3 Practical Contribution**
- Direct intervention or policy implication
- Clinical or organizational application
- Stakeholder decision-making support
- Tool or resource creation
- Training or educational application

**4.4 Field Impact**
- Opens new research stream
- Resolves standing debate
- Shifts methodological norms
- Bridges sub-disciplines
- Influences funding priorities

#### Contribution Statement Template
```
This study contributes to [FIELD] by [CONTRIBUTION TYPE] [WHAT IS CONTRIBUTED],
which [HOW IT ADVANCES] [SPECIFIC AREA], thereby [BROADER IMPLICATION].
Unlike prior work that [WHAT OTHERS DID], this study [WHAT IS DIFFERENT AND BETTER].
```

**Quality Gate:** The research must articulate at least one contribution in at least two domains. At least one contribution must be rated "substantial" (not merely incremental).

### PHASE 5: NOVELTY CERTIFICATE

**Objective:** Quantify the novelty of the proposed research using the four-dimension scoring system and issue a formal novelty assessment.

#### Scoring Dimensions (0–25 each)

| Dimension | 21–25 | 16–20 | 11–15 | 6–10 | 0–5 |
|-----------|-------|-------|-------|------|-----|
| **First-of-its-kind** | No prior work in this space | One preliminary study exists | A few studies exist but are narrow | Several studies exist | Well-trodden territory |
| **Methodological Innovation** | Entirely new method or paradigm | Significant adaptation of existing method | Moderate methodological refinement | Minor methodological tweak | Standard method, no innovation |
| **Theoretical Advancement** | New theory or paradigm shift | Major theory extension | Moderate theory refinement | Minor theoretical nuance | No theoretical contribution |
| **Empirical Impact** | Findings would reshape the field | Findings would influence multiple sub-fields | Findings would influence one sub-field | Findings would be cited but not transformative | Findings would have limited reach |

#### Total Score Bands

| Score Range | Classification | Description |
|-------------|---------------|-------------|
| 90–100 | **Paradigm Shift** | Field-altering work; will be cited for decades |
| 75–89 | **Major Contribution** | Substantially advances understanding; high-impact publication likely |
| 60–74 | **Solid Contribution** | Meaningful advance; suitable for strong specialty journal |
| 45–59 | **Incremental** | Adds to literature but does not shift understanding |
| 30–44 | **Marginal** | Limited novelty; significant revision needed |
| 0–29 | **Redundant** | Insufficient novelty; do not pursue in current form |
